About 3-[(4-chloro-6-methoxy-1,3,5-triazin-2-yl)sulfanyl]-4-ethyl-1H-1,2,4-triazol-5-one
3-[(4-chloro-6-methoxy-1,3,5-triazin-2-yl)sulfanyl]-4-ethyl-1H-1,2,4-triazol-5-one (PubChem CID 55129236) has the molecular formula C8H9ClN6O2S
and a molecular weight of 288.72 g/mol. Its IUPAC name is 3-[(4-chloro-6-methoxy-1,3,5-triazin-2-yl)sulfanyl]-4-ethyl-1H-1,2,4-triazol-5-one.

What is the SMILES notation for 3-[(4-chloro-6-methoxy-1,3,5-triazin-2-yl)sulfanyl]-4-ethyl-1H-1,2,4-triazol-5-one?
The canonical SMILES for 3-[(4-chloro-6-methoxy-1,3,5-triazin-2-yl)sulfanyl]-4-ethyl-1H-1,2,4-triazol-5-one is CCn1c(Sc2nc(Cl)nc(OC)n2)n[nH]c1=O.
What is the InChIKey of 3-[(4-chloro-6-methoxy-1,3,5-triazin-2-yl)sulfanyl]-4-ethyl-1H-1,2,4-triazol-5-one?
The InChIKey is XJQWICMNVGIKSK-UHFFFAOYSA-N. The full InChI is InChI=1S/C8H9ClN6O2S/c1-3-15-7(16)13-14-8(15)18-6-11-4(9)10-5(12-6)17-2/h3H2,1-2H3,(H,13,16).
What are the key properties of 3-[(4-chloro-6-methoxy-1,3,5-triazin-2-yl)sulfanyl]-4-ethyl-1H-1,2,4-triazol-5-one?
3-[(4-chloro-6-methoxy-1,3,5-triazin-2-yl)sulfanyl]-4-ethyl-1H-1,2,4-triazol-5-one has a molecular weight of 288.72 g/mol, XLogP of 0.59, 4 rotatable bonds, 1 hydrogen bond donors, and 8 hydrogen bond acceptors.
